ERTICO News: ERTICO’s Public Authorities Platform meets in Paris
Date: 03 October 2008
The meeting was held in the spectacular Arche de la Défense in Paris, hosted by ERTICO – ITS Europe Partner, the Ministry of Ecology, Sustainable Development and Spatial Planning. Pascale Buchs, Deputy Director of the Interministerial Delegation for Road Safety in France, gave a very interesting introductory presentation on the status of ITS in France, explaining that road safety has been a top priority in France since 2002 and there had been a dramatic decrease in the number of fatalities and injuries since 2003 when RADAR units started to be installed.
The meeting went on to discuss current and future ERTICO activities and the Public Authorities role within them. In addition Mrs Lundgren from the Swedish Road Administration gave an insight into the project Easyway with its objectives of identifying ITS services and providing guidelines for deployment of these services. Participants gave updates on the latest ITS developments in their countries and also discussed further involvement of the Public Authorities in the area of cooperative mobility.
During the afternoon, members of ITS France gave presentations on E-call – looking at the services developed by PSA as well as new projects developed by IMA and ITS actions developed by ASFA (association of the highways operating companies). Bernard Basset, President of ITS-France, gave an overview of the national association’s activities.
